Determining the "fastest" internet provider in Woodward depends heavily on availability at your specific address. Currently, T-Mobile 5G Home Internet and Verizon 5G Home Internet compete in terms of speed and availability, followed by HughesNet and Viasat. While AT&T's DSL service is widely available, it is not typically considered the fastest option. Fiber-optic availability remains extremely limited in Woodward. Fixed Wireless is becoming a leading contender.
Provider | Technology | Download Speed (Up to) | Upload Speed (Up to) |
---|---|---|---|
T-Mobile 5G Home Internet | Fixed Wireless | 100 Mbps | 20 Mbps |
Verizon 5G Home Internet | Fixed Wireless | 85 Mbps | 10 Mbps |
Viasat | Satellite | 25 Mbps | 3 Mbps |
HughesNet | Satellite | 25 Mbps | 3 Mbps |
AT&T Internet | DSL | 10 Mbps | 1 Mbps |
*Speeds are "up to" and may vary based on location, network congestion, and other factors. Check with each provider for specific speed availability at your address.

Residential internet coverage in Woodward, Oklahoma is generally considered good, but the type of internet available to you will vary based on your specific location. Satellite internet providers Viasat and HughesNet offer near-universal coverage, making them accessible to virtually all residents. AT&T Internet's DSL service is also fairly widespread. T-Mobile and Verizon 5G home internet coverage is increasing. It's always recommended to check the coverage maps of each provider for the most accurate picture of availability at your address.
